At Cleveland Clinic, you will work alongside passionate and dedicated caregivers, receive endless support and appreciation, and build a rewarding career with one of the most respected healthcare organizations in the worldAs an Executive Secretary, you will provide administrative support for executive level managers. Your primary duties will include, but are not limited to: - Coordinating diverse activities and interacting with various organizational units. - Dealing with highly confidential and organizationally sensitive matters. - Receiving and screening visitors. - Scheduling and coordinating meetings, conferences, special events, appointments, and travel arrangements. The ideal future caregiver is someone who: - Has experience as an administrative assistant for a physician. - Is professional, organized, and a team-player. - Demonstrates leadership and conflict resolution skills. - Can support and maintain several projects. - Has excellent record keeping and filing skills. When you join Cleveland Clinic, you'll be part of a supportive caregiver family that will be united in shared values and purpose to fulfill our promise of being the best place to receive care and the best place to work in healthcare.Responsibilities:Provides administrative support for executive level managers.Coordinates diverse activities, interacts with various organizational units, utilizes conflict resolution and deals with highly confidential and organizationally sensitive matters.Receives and screens visitors while answering telephone calls then uses independent judgment to determine priority and sensitivity of inquiries and responses.Prepares and supervises the preparation of correspondence, forms, reports and other written communications.Schedules and coordinates; meetings, conferences, special events, appointments and travel arrangements.Maintains assigned calendar(s). Originates, prepares, processes and edits personnel, financial or operational reports and documents.Other duties as assigned.Education: High School Diploma or GED.Four years of college and/or business school preferred; specialized training in desktop office software preferred.Certifications: None plexity of Work:Requires critical thinking skills, decisive judgment and the ability to work with minimal supervision.Must be able to work in a stressful environment and take appropriate action.Work Experience: Minimum five years experience in a medical, commercial or industrial environment that included the coordination of diverse activities, interaction with various organizational units, conflict resolution and dealing with highly confidential and organizationally sensitive matters.May require a minimum typing proficiency of 65 wpm with accuracy.Physical Requirements:Ability to perform work in a stationary position for extended periodsAbility to operate a computer and other office equipmentAbility to communicate and exchange accurate informationPersonal Protective Equipment:Follows standard precautions using personal protective equipment as required.Pay RangeMinimum hourly: $20.77Maximum hourly: $31.68The pay range displayed on this job posting reflects the anticipated range for new hires. While the pay range is displayed as an hourly rate, Cleveland Clinic recruiters will clarify whether the compensation is hourly or salary. A successful candidate's actual compensation will be determined after taking factors into consideration such as the candidate's work history, experience, skill set, and education. This is not inclusive of the value of Cleveland Clinic's benefits package, which includes among other benefits, healthcare/dental/vision and retirement.
